Ludmila Korobeshko from the expedition to McKinley: the team have a rest day at Rangers Camp

Good afternoon! Ludmila Korobeshko reports from the expedition to McKinley. We are now in Camp Ranger, at 4300 ... Today, June 30th, we have a day of rest. Yesterday we nade a depot, as planned in the assault camp. In fact, the day was quite heavy. We woke up early, but it was very cold at night, probably minus twenty. So we decided to wait for the sun, and only 11 a.m. we left the camp. Gone with fixed ropes and a little more along the ridge to Washburn’s Thumb. We returned happy but tired. So today the rest is very logical. In addition, the snow began at night ... We rest, look at weather forecasts and are already preparing for a summit bid. As soon as the window will appear, we will try to go upstairs to the assault camp, well, then, according the weather - on the ascent. All members feel good. Best regards!

 

 

 

 

 

 

Climbing Demavend: impressions and photos

We (Igor and I) climbed the top twice - on Friday and Saturday. Andrey did not reached the summit on a Friday and we decided to accompany him on Saturday. In general, the ascent is quite simple - the guides told us that we could go without them, there is only one road, so that we went ourselves. In terms of organization, there have been some delays along the route, but still within a few slow "Eastern" the passage of time. We like a refuge – it is very comfortable. All: electricity, water, toilet - at the highest level. Guides, Miriam and Mohamed, pleasant to talk to, but not really sportive .... Hotel became lower class than expected (breakfast was so-so), but it's still Iran. We liked that the head of the agency, Ali invited us to dinner at his home on Sunday. Very warmly welcomed, treated, showed how the Iranians live at home, meet their friends. We thank him for it!

Day of adventure on McKinley, The Mount gave to feel the force

Hello! There is Ludmila Korobeshko from the expedition to McKinley. Today we had a day of adventure, so to speak. And the Mount showed to some extent, a difficult character. It all started as usual on the plan, as we planned. At 4 am we went out and walked through Windy Corner, we went to the place of getting a depot. And as we walked quickly and vigorously, we decided to bring our depot even to the Camp Ranger. We dug in it and on the way back, near Windy Corner, a strong wind started ... and also started a blizzard, snow. And all this went on until the camp. With difficulty we have found in this blizzard our camp. We were happy that we managed to do. The weather turned bad and our plans may change, but we have time to spare. Bye!

Survival School in Chamonix: classes are held for any weather

Alex Abramov from Chamonix: Yesterday our team "survival school” in Chamonix moved to Italian side and rose to Helbronner station, 3350m altitude. There we were met by a snowstorm. That is to say, from summer to winter.

By lunchtime, the weather became better and we were able to hold classes on climb-up - traverse- descent on fixed ropes. Also as self-arrest and belay on the snow.

Then put up a tent, we have worked at overnight in tents in the snow.
In the morning the weather has finally deteriorated, however, our team still managed to climb the nearest “unnamed” peak.

We gave it a new name - La Pipka.

All members of the group agreed that, classes were great, it was very interesting and useful.

Group of 7 Summits Club in Talkeetna. Report and photos by Ludmila Korobeshko

Ludmila Korobeshko from Talkeetna, Alaska.

Today, June 20th we are finally altogether, joined by Sigmund Berdychowsky and Andrey Kartushin.
In the morning we were completed our shopping and arrived in Talkeetna to the dinner time. On the way we passed large areas of burnt and even steaming forest. A few days ago there were blazing fires.
In Talkeetna we acquainted with the main sights - Main Street – it is 200 meters long, waterfront Susitna, airfields and TAT office, from where we plan to depart tomorrow Kahiltna Glacier.

Tomorrow we will have a very busy day: at 7 am we go to the office "Alpine Asñents International" (company partner), packing, check the equipment, go to the Rangers for registration and then to the airport for departure. I keep my fingers crossed that the weather allowed to implement his plan.
